Karanovo: Die Ausgrabungen im Südsektor 1984-1992by Stefan Hiller and Vassil NikolovKaranovo is known as one of the most outstanding prehistoric sites in South-Eastern Europe. Unfortunately, little of the material which was found during the 1947-1957 excavations has been published. A new project has been carrying out excavations since 1984, led by a joint Bulgarian-Austrian team. The aim is to provide a more detailed picture of the stratigraphy and small finds. This is the first volume on the recent excavations, containing the results from work carried out between 1984 and 1992. A great deal of Neolithic material was found, particularly from the Early Neolithic period: but there were also rich deposits from Chalcolithic and Early Bronze Age pits. Two volumes.
